原文:nm 命令中的T和U

T:該符號位於代碼段 U:該符號在當前文件中是未定義的,即該符號的定義在別的文件中。例如,當前文件調用另一個文件中定義的函數,在這個被調用的函數在當前就是未定義的 但是在定義它的文件中類型是T。但是對於全局變量來說,在定義它的文件中,其符號類型為C,在使用它的文件中,其類型為U ...

2022-03-05 09:25 0 2591 推薦指數:

查看詳情

linuxnm命令簡介

的縮寫, 當然, 也不是ni mei的縮寫, 而是names的縮寫, nm命令主要是用來列出某些文件的 ...

Thu Nov 10 03:03:00 CST 2016 0 25545
【Linux】nm命令符號類型詳解

DATE: 2018.11.13 轉載自:https://www.cnblogs.com/LiuYanYGZ/p/5536607.html#top nm命令介紹的很多,但大多不介紹其函數符號標志的含義。 最近在調試動態庫時常用到,其中用的最多的用法: nm -A * |grep “aaa ...

Wed Nov 14 01:20:00 CST 2018 0 796
nm命令符號類型詳解

摘自http://blog.csdn.net/solmyr_biti/article/details/6565479 nm命令介紹的很多,但大多不介紹其函數符號標志的含義。最近在調試動態庫時常用到,其中用的最多的用法:nm -A * |grep “aaa” | c++filt ...

Sat May 28 08:34:00 CST 2016 0 10501
【Linux命令nm查看動態和靜態庫的符號

功能 列出.o .a .so的符號信息,包括諸如符號的值,符號類型及符號名稱等。所謂符號,通常指定義出的函數,全局變量等等。 使用 nm [option(s)] [file(s)] 有用的options: -A 在每個符號信息的前面打印所在對象文件名稱; -C 輸出 ...

Tue Oct 26 18:15:00 CST 2021 0 104
nm和readelf命令的區別

其實問題的本質是對elf格式的理解問題,因為是查看so庫的符號表發現的問題。 事情起因是這樣的,由於我的一個程序編譯的時候出現了undefined reference to “XXX”的錯誤,需要鏈接特定的so庫,發現用nm [file]找不到“XXX”函數符號,結果用readelf -s ...

Mon Nov 17 18:42:00 CST 2014 0 5852
nm命令詳解

前言 nm是name的縮寫,它顯示指定文件的符號信息,文件可以是對象文件、可執行文件或對象文件庫。如果文件沒有包含符號信息,nm報告該情況,單不把他解釋為出錯。nm缺省情況下報告十進制符號表示法下的數字值。 選項 -a/--debug-syms:顯示所有符號,包括 ...

Thu Dec 12 07:20:00 CST 2019 0 638
nm命令詳解

nm在linux列出目標文件的符號清單,常用來查看動態鏈接庫的函數 nm支持的選項如下 -a 按照man手冊,僅列出調試信息,實際上卻是調試信息+正常信息 -A 增加一列顯示目標文件,沒有實際意義 -C 將低級符號信息編碼成便於查看的用戶信息 ...

Wed Aug 20 17:59:00 CST 2014 0 4403
nm

nm命令介紹的很多,但大多不介紹其函數符號標志的含義。最近在調試動態庫時常用到,其中用的最多的用法:nm -A * |grep “aaa” | c++filt // -A 為了顯示文件, c++filt轉換為可讀風格,好像有個參數也能實現類似功能 其他內容整理如下(原作者未知 ...

Thu Nov 11 23:52:00 CST 2021 0 2189
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M